A leading sports organization in York is looking for multi-activity coaches and activity leaders for their holiday clubs. The role involves working with children aged 5-13, conducting engaging sports, arts & crafts activities.
Flexible working arrangements are possible, catering to your availability over holiday periods such as Easter and Summer. Coaching or teaching qualifications are desirable but not essential, as experience with children is crucial.
This position offers both full-time and part-time opportunities, with competitive pay between £340.00-£450.00 per week.

How to prepare for a job interview at Total Sports Limited
✨Know Your Audience
Before the interview, take some time to understand the age group you'll be working with. Familiarise yourself with activities that engage children aged 5-13, as this will show your potential employer that you’re not just passionate about sports but also about making it fun for kids.
✨Showcase Your Experience
Even if you don’t have formal coaching qualifications, highlight any relevant experience you have with children. Share specific examples of activities you've led or how you've engaged kids in sports or arts & crafts. This will demonstrate your ability to connect with the young ones.
✨Be Flexible and Open-Minded
Since the role offers flexible working arrangements, be prepared to discuss your availability during holiday periods. Show that you’re adaptable and willing to work around the needs of the organisation, which is a big plus for them.
✨Prepare Questions
At the end of the interview, you’ll likely be asked if you have any questions. Prepare thoughtful questions about the holiday club’s activities, team dynamics, or how they measure success in their programmes.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it’s the right fit for you.
